Output d63afaa158aaac91bafe574f0417a7d851f455360ec4296ea258bdbaf061cddf:0

value
80440869131493
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b61c14454296ebf4f91a18f7a2d7fd4fcd852a97 OP_EQUALVERIFY OP_CHECKSIG
address
DMk1A9Vstxm93BTd7oqh7o3w3M7skqWbbw
transaction
d63afaa158aaac91bafe574f0417a7d851f455360ec4296ea258bdbaf061cddf